Qualify a concatenated table

Hello

I am Qualifying some tables but I have a concatenated table

I have put the following but it does not seem to work and only picks up the first table

Qualify*;
main_data_diag:

LOAD
'inpatients'
as data_source_diag,
applymap('MAPPING', [specialty]) AS SPEC

FROM
C:\Inpatients_Diagnostics_Weekly.qvd
(
qvd);


Qualify*;

Concatenate (main_data_diag)LOAD
'Outpatients'
as data_source_diag,

applymap('MAPPING', [referral_specialty_code]) AS SPEC

FROM
C:\Outpatients_Diagnostics_Weekly.qvd
(
qvd);

How do I get the qualify to work on a concatenated table?  I have tried taking out the Qualify*; and I still do not get the desired result

Any ideas?

Thanks

Helen

I just stumbled similar issue, and I did concatenated without qualifying for the specific 2 tables, then:

RENAME TABLE (concatenated table) to tmp;

Qualify *;

NoConcatenate PROD: LOAD * resident tmp;

Unqualify *;

DROP TABLE tmp;

Is necessary:

1) load first table 2) load (and concatenate) second table 3) load 'resident' table and here QUALIFY fields.

I hope this help you. Lucio

// uso di CONCATENATE and QUALIFY

TABELLA:
LOAD
CodProd,
QtaVend,
Prz,
Venduto,
DataDocV,
Cliente,
Magazzino
FROM [lib://Test/test.xlsx]
(ooxml, embedded labels, table is Vend);

Concatenate
LOAD
CodProd,
QtaVend,
Prz,
Venduto,
DataDocV,
Cliente,
Magazzino
FROM [lib://Test/test.xlsx]
(ooxml, embedded labels, table is Vend2);

TABELLA2:
Qualify *;
NOConcatenate
LOAD
*
resident TABELLA;

drop table TABELLA;
